Postmortem timeline — Lanternboard dark mode

14:02 — Dark-mode toggle shipped to the Lanternboard admin dashboard.
14:19 — Plugin panels rendered unreadable; theme variables not propagated to iframe contexts.
14:33 — Rollback initiated.
14:47 — Hotfix exposing theme tokens to plugin sandboxes deployed.

Plugin authors: consume the new theme variables rather than hardcoding colors. The hotfix build reference follows.

session token of taduf-tahog = htk4_91a1

Meeting notes, Lanternfish API sync. Decided: cursor-based pagination only; offset params deprecated next quarter. Cursors are opaque, base-encoded, expire after 24h. Max page size 200, default 50. Clients must treat `next` as absent-means-done. Rate limits unchanged. Open item: backfill docs for the Quayside partner tier before deprecation notice ships. Rollout gated behind the v3 flag. Ownership of the pagination module and the deprecation timeline rests with the maintainer listed below.

named custodian: Brivan Eliath Quenox Frador

## Formula sandbox tuning

User-supplied formulas in Gridmoor execute inside a restricted interpreter with hard ceilings on time, memory, and call depth. Reviewers should confirm any change to these ceilings is justified in the PR description, since raising them widens the abuse surface. Defaults were chosen from production traces. The current limits are as follows.

limits module of tafog-fawip:
WEIGHTS = {
    "julix": 57,
    "lamys": 992,
    "kasvan": 209,
    "quenok": 750,
    "alddor": 259,
    "oliath": 1009,
    "wenix": 815,
}

Runbook: LinguaSweep extraction. The script scans the Fernvale monorepo nightly, pulls untranslated strings, and pushes them to the Glossa staging queue. It runs as the ci-l10n user with read-only repo scope. Network egress is restricted to the Glossa gateway. Authentication to the gateway uses the key below.

app token of kafop-hahaf = kto11_iRLdsMBafGn